Serial response delay
Offset 0x5E
Type unsigned 8-bit
Data time in units of milliseconds
Default 0
Range 0 to 255
Settings file serial_response_delay
Tic Control Center Input and motor settings, Serial box, Response delay
This setting specifies the minimum amount of time to wait, in microseconds, before processing an I²C
byte or sending a serial response. This setting was added in firmware version 1.02.
VIN measurement calibration
Offset 0x14
Type signed 16-bit
Default 0
Range −500 to +500
Settings file vin_calibration
Tic Control Center Advanced settings tab, Miscellaneous box, VIN measurement calibration
This setting adjusts the scaling of the Tic’s VIN measurements. If the Tic’s VIN readings are lower than
the actual VIN voltage, you can use a positive value to scale the readings up. If the readings are high,
you can use a negative value to scale the readings down. On the Tic T825, a value of 33 corresponds
to a 4% change. On the Tic T834, a value of 9 corresponds to a 4% change.
